ABBEY LABORATORIES PTY LTD COXI-STOP 25 COCCIDIOCIDE SOLUTION FOR POULTRY 80980/107353 COMPANY NAME: PRODUCT NAME: APVMA APPROVAL NO: LABEL NAME: COXI-STOP 25 COCCIDIOCIDE SOLUTION FOR POULTRY SIGNAL HEADINGS: CAUTION KEEP OUT OF REACH OF CHILDREN FOR ANIMAL TREATMENT ONLY READ SAFETY DIRECTIONS CONSTITUENT STATEMENTS: 25 g/L TOLTRAZURIL CLAIMS: FOR THE TREATMENT AND CONTROL OF COCCIDIOSIS IN CHICKENS CAUSED BY EIMERIA SPECIES COXI-STOP 25 is added to the drinking water of chickens for the treatment and control of coccidiosis caused by Eimeria species including: Eimeria tenella, Eimeria necatrix, Eimeria acervulina and Eimeria maxima. NET CONTENTS: 1L, 2.5L, 5L, and 10L DIRECTIONS FOR USE: RESTRAINTS: DO NOT treat replacement pullets more than twice CONTRAINDICATIONS: PRECAUTIONS: SIDE EFFECTS: DOSAGE AND ADMINISTRATION: COXI-STOP 25 is administered in drinking water at a dose rate of 7mg/kg bodyweight/day and a final drinking water concentration of 75mg/L. RLP APPROVED One mL of COXI-STOP 25 contains 25mg of the active ingredient Toltrazuril. COXI-STOP 25 is diluted at the rate of 3 litres per 1000 litres of drinking water (3: 1000) and administered on 2 consecutive days with an 8 hour treatment period on both days. Add the required amount of COXI-STOP 25 to the amount of water consumed in an 8 hour period and stir thoroughly. Allow for varying water consumption during hot weather. Treat the birds for 8 hours each day for 2 days (2x8 hour treatments). All other sources of drinking water should be withheld during the 8 hour treatment period. Ensure full lighting conditions during treatment. Do not withhold feed during treatment. GENERAL DIRECTIONS: DO NOT USE GALVANISED OR RUSTY IRON WATER TANKS AND RETICULATION SYSTEMS. COXI-STOP 25 mixes with all types of water. However in areas where the drinking water is acidic, the water should be tested with pH test strips and brought to a minimum pH of 8.5 using sodium carbonate (washing soda).
